Crossing the tidal road to Lindisfarne, the Holy Island

WebA TIDAL ISLAND: Holy Island is linked to the mainland by a long causeway. Twice each day the tide sweeps in from the North Sea and covers the road. ... The causeway … WebHoly Island is only accessible by crossing a tidal causeway from the mainland. This causeway is only accessible at LOW TIDE. It is essential to check the safe crossing times before you travel. The 477 service. Because the causeway to Holy Island is tidal, the timetable changes virtually daily. Usually, the 15.20 sailing from Ardrossan Harbour is the latest you can catch in order to … WebIMPORTANT SAFETY NOTES. These indicative times are provided for visitors planning to use the Lindisfarne Causeway ROAD to access (or return from) Holy island. The times should be treated with caution, as local weather conditions (such as high wind) can change them. Always allow 30 minutes extra time to compensate for these variables.
